What is a mesothelioma suit?

Mesothelioma lawsuits are filed by injured asbestos victims or their family members to seek compensation from companies that are responsible for the exposure. The amount of compensation awarded in a successful claim can help pay funeral expenses, medical bills loss of income, and other related damages.

Settlement negotiations or trial can settle lawsuits. Mesothelioma cases require the presentation of evidence before a judge and jury. The outcome is uncertain. In a successful trial, plaintiffs could receive a higher award of damages than in a settlement.

It is important to start your lawsuit before the statute of limitations runs out in the state you reside in. The statute of limitations differs according to state, and is determined by when you were diagnosed with mesothelioma or any other asbestos-related illnesses. How long do I need to file mesothelioma claims?

While the timeline for filing mesothelioma lawsuits differs by state, most victims are able to file within one to three years. To ensure that they are within the state's statutes or limitations, it is essential to consult a mesothelioma lawyer as soon as possible. Failure to do this could prevent a person from submitting an action.

A mesothelioma suit could take up to one year to settle and is typically resolved outside of courtroom. How much should I expect to get in a mesothelioma case?

Many factors affect the amount mesothelioma patient receives as settlement. The type of asbestos firm involved, how much a victim was exposed to asbestos, and the state's laws all play a role in the final outcome. Compensation typically covers med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ering. A mesothelioma-related case can be settled in a few weeks or less depending on the state laws and the particular case. Most mesothelioma lawsuits are settled through a settlement, instead of trial. A settlement is a deal between the defendants and the victim to settle the case without a court hearing. Many victims of mesothelioma settle to avoid the lengthy and costly trial procedure.

The mesothelioma settlement average is between $1 million and $1.4 million. However, a victim may receive a lower or higher settlement. Mesothelioma cases that do not settle usually result with a verdict by a jury. This could result in a lower or higher amount of money.

In addition to a mesothelioma settlement, the victim can also get compensation from asbestos trust funds that have been created by asbestos manufacturers that have filed for bankruptcy. These asbestos trust funds are designed to pay mesothelioma victims who are unable to or unwilling to go to trial.

Taxes are not generally levied on the compensation received from asbestos trust funds and mesothelioma lawsuits. It is crucial to consult with an experienced mesothelioma lawyer to learn the tax implications that will affect your case and the amount of compensation you are entitled to.
